On Mar 24th, we present : "Fast Food Frenzy: What Happens After the First Bite?" by Prof. Roula Andreopoulos, MSc, PhD, ACUE — University of Toronto


You ate it. It tasted amazing. But do you know what happens next?

In Fast Food Frenzy, award-winning educator Prof. Roula Andreopoulos takes you on a journey through what actually happens inside your body after a fast-food meal.


From the first bite of a burger to the last sip of soda, we’ll follow carbohydrates, fats, and proteins as they sprint, slide, and occasionally crash their way through your metabolism. You’ll learn how nutrients are broken down, absorbed, and transformed into energy — or quietly stored for later (like leftovers you didn’t plan on keeping).


This interactive talk separates myth from science, explaining how your body responds to fast food in real time — no biochemistry background required. Expect audience polls, “wait… what?!” moments, and a newfound respect for your liver, pancreas, and mitochondria, which are working overtime every time you hit the drive-thru.


Real science. Big laughs. Zero guilt — just understanding.



🍿 About the incredible Professor Roula Andreopoulos

Professor Roula Andreopoulos is a highly regarded educator and scientist at the University of Toronto, known for her ability to make complex biological processes accessible, engaging, and fun. She is a 3M National Teaching Fellow, one of Canada’s highest honors for university teaching, recognized for excellence and leadership in education.

She also directs Canada’s only Amgen Scholars Program, supporting undergraduate researchers—especially those from historically marginalized communities—in developing research and communication skills. Consistently praised by students, Andreopoulos is known for making complex science clear, engaging, and fun.
